Dome Types Fiber Optic Splice Closure Is a kind ofHigh protective fiber fusion protection equipmentThe unique dome structure is designed specifically forComplex environment optical network deploymentDesign.
Its core functions include:
Fully sealed protectionProvide a waterproof, dustproof and impact-resistant enclosed space for the fiber fusion joint.
Mass managementSupport multi-core cable welding and branching, suitable for dense optical networks.
rapid deploymentModular design simplifies the installation process and supports tool-free operation.
Environmental adaptabilityFrom overhead to direct burial, covering a variety of outdoor scenes.
Independent tray: supports layered splicing and is suitable for ribbon optical cables (such as 12-core ribbon optical fibers).
Fiber tray space: bending radius ≥ 50mm, in line with TIA-568-C.3 standard.
Quick Access Port:
Type: supports FC/SC/LC/ST adapters, compatible with pre-terminated MPO/MTP.
Scalability: 20% port redundancy is reserved to support future expansion.
Intelligent Management:
Optional functions: RFID tag slot, temperature and humidity sensor, fiber status monitoring interface.

Installation method:
Aerial/Pipeline: with hanging ears or clamp bracket.
Direct burial: optional pressure-resistant cover (load bearing ≥5 tons).
Activation mechanism:
Tool-free design: quick lock (opening time ≤10 seconds).
Sealing: silicone seal + stainless steel lock, reuse ≥1000 times.
Dome Types Fiber Splice Closure Typical Application Scenarios
FTTH/FTTx network:
Outdoor splitter box and trunk cable splice protection.
Long-distance trunk transmission:
Relay splice node of pipeline or aerial optical cable.
Industrial network:
Optical fiber link of petroleum, petrochemical, and power SCADA systems.
5G base station backhaul:
Frequency protection of fronthaul optical cable and BBU/RRU equipment.
Smart City:
Outdoor connection point of IoT devices such as monitoring and traffic signals.

A dome type fiber optic splice closure is a protective housing designed to hold and protect fiber optic splices in outdoor or underground environments. It features a cylindrical "dome" shape, offering excellent sealing and pressure resistance, making it ideal for harsh conditions.
✅ Answer:
Dome type closures are known for their strong waterproofing, large capacity for splice trays, and high durability. They offer easy maintenance and can be reused after re-entry. The dome structure provides uniform stress resistance, making it suitable for aerial, pole, and buried applications.
✅ Answer:
Most dome splice closures support 4 to 16 cable entry ports and can manage anywhere from 24 to over 144 fiber cores, depending on the model and tray configuration. High-capacity models are available for backbone fiber networks.
✅ Answer:
The key difference is in the shape and application. Dome type closures are vertical and ideal for underground or pole installations with better pressure resistance, while horizontal types are flat and often used for aerial or wall-mounted setups. Dome closures usually provide better water and air sealing.
✅ Answer:
Yes, dome splice closures are designed to be reusable. Technicians can open them for maintenance or upgrades and then reseal them without affecting performance. Most models use rubber gaskets and mechanical sealing systems to maintain waterproof integrity after re-entry.
